The product of a three‐component reaction (3‐CR) is formed only if all reagents, the allenyl isothiocyanate, the nucleophile NuH (sec. amine), and the electrophile E+ (Michael acceptor, aldehyde, etc.) are present at the same time; otherwise a simple thiazole is generated by tautomerism (~ H+).
